John C. Begeny Amy Lynn Hawkins Hailey E. Krouse Kelly M. Laugle 《Psychology in the schools》2011,48(8):769-785
With limited educational resources and numerous other variables that complicate effective teaching, educators need to think prudently about how to allocate resources. In essence, teachers must allocate resources in ways that will best maximize student learning. However, minimal research has systematically evaluated whether increased instructional intensity and resources meaningfully increase instructional effectiveness. As a preliminary attempt to address this research question, this study systematically evaluated the differential effectiveness of three intervention options that integrated the same instructional components but required varying levels of resources (i.e., teacher time for instructional delivery). To better isolate the research question, this study specifically evaluated interventions designed to improve students' reading fluency. Overall findings suggested that increased instructional intensity does not necessarily equate with increased instructional effectiveness. © 2011 Wiley Periodicals, Inc. 相似文献

Su Zhixin Hawkins John N. Huang Tao Zhao Zhiyi 《International Review of Education/Internationale Zeitschrift für Erziehungswissenschaft/Revue internationale l'éducation》2001,47(6):611-635
In this article, the researchers report findings from a recent national study of teacher education in China, in comparison to similar data from national and case studies in the United States. The study aims at understanding and comparing the profiles and entry perspectives of Chinese versus American teacher candidates. The researchers demonstrate that there are both similarities and differences in the demographic characteristics of the Chinese and American teacher candidates. The Chinese education students come from less privileged backgrounds in socioeconomic status and academic preparation. Although they share some of the noble ideas about becoming teachers, the overwhelming majority of the Chinese students do not intend to commit to teaching as a lifelong career. They cite the low status of the teaching profession and the poor benefits for teachers as primary reasons for leaving teaching. The researchers urge Chinese and American policy makers and teacher educators to revise their policies and practices in light of the study findings in order to recruit qualified young people into teacher education programs and more importantly to retain good teachers in the profession. 相似文献

Les Tickle 《Journal of Philosophy of Education》2001,35(3):345-359
The chapter records personal accounts of the author's dealings with dilemmas encountered in the research methods literature and in the field of practice, as an action researcher and teacher educator. It draws on Mary Chamberlain's Fenwomen to illustrate some of the dangers of ethnographic research. Using data from two instances, one in a pre-service initial teacher-training programme and the other in teacher induction, the author draws out the tensions between the 'need to know' in order to act professionally, and the 'need to protect' in order to do the same. 相似文献

Kevin Watson Frances Steele Les Vozzo Peter Aubusson 《Research in Science Education》2007,37(2):141-154
This paper reports the experiences of teachers involved in a novel retraining scheme designed to meet a short-term crisis
in numbers of teachers of physics. Teachers trained in other subject areas underwent an intensive six-month training in physics
and were then placed in schools. During the first year of teaching some support for ongoing learning in science was provided.
A study of these teachers' experiences found they lacked content knowledge in areas of the curriculum other than physics and
were unprepared for the reality of the science classroom. Their existing classroom management skills were of only limited
value in the new context. For those graduates who were supported by experienced staff in schools, the transition to science
teaching was hard but ultimately worthwhile. For some, whose qualifications to teach science were never accepted by their
peers, retraining was a bitter experience. 相似文献

Shaw David E. Becker Henry J. Bransford John D. Davidson Jan Hawkins Jan Malcom Shirley Molina Mario Ride Sally K. Sharp Phillip Tinker Robert F. Vest Charles Young John Allen Richard Bakia Marianne Bryson Rebecca Chen C. Samantha Costello Caroline M. Deckel Garrett M. Dial Marjorie R. Kealey Edith M. Lehoczky Sandor 《Journal of Science Education and Technology》1998,7(2):115-126
The Panel on Educational Technology was organized in April 1995 under the auspices of the President's Committee of Advisers on Science and Technology (PCAST) to provide advice to the President on matters related to the application of information technologies to K–12 education in the United States. Its findings and recommendations were set forth in March 1997 in the Report to the President on the Use of Technology to Strengthen K–12 Education in the United States. This report was based on a review of the research literature and on written submissions and oral briefings from a number of academic and industrial researchers, practicing educators, software developers, governmental agencies, and professional and industry organizations involved in various ways with the application of technology to education. Its most important finding is that a large-scale program of rigorous, systematic research on education in general and educational technology in particular will ultimately prove necessary to ensure both the efficacy and cost-effectiveness of technology use within our nation's K–12 schools. Finding that less than 0.1 percent of our nation's expenditures for elementary and secondary education are currently invested to determine which educational techniques actually work, and to find ways to improve them—an extremely low level relative to comparable ratios within the private sector—the Panel recommended that this figure be increased over a period of several years to at least 0.5 percent, and sustained at that level on an ongoing basis. Further, because no one state, municipality, or private firm could hope to capture more than a small fraction of the benefits associated with a significant advance in our understanding of how best to educate K–12 students, the Panel concluded that such funding will have to be provided largely at the federal level in order to avoid a systematic underinvestment (attributable to a classical form of economic externality) relative to the level that would be optimal for the nation as a whole. The Dyslexia Pilot Project provided funding to school districts to implement a multitiered system of support (MTSS) framework for the prevention, early identification, and early intervention of reading difficulties. This article describes the evaluation of the multiyear Dyslexia Pilot Project for students in kindergarten through Grade 2. The evaluation extended a conceptual model for evaluating the systems effects of an MTSS for reading by including a cost-effectiveness analysis. The results indicate that mean rates of improvement on Dynamic Indicators for Basic Early Literacy Skills Next curriculum-based measures for students in participating schools exceeded the expected rates of improvement based on benchmark norms. This reduction in risk precluded the need for more intensive, individualized, and costly interventions and specialized educational services. Implications of the findings and future directions are discussed. 相似文献
